Maintaining the Restored Door

After the restoration process is complete, it’s important to maintain the beauty and integrity of your door. Here are some tips for maintaining your restored wood door:

– Regular Cleaning: Keep your door clean by gently washing it with a mild soap and water solution, and av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ners.

– Protective Coatings: Consider applying a protective coating to your restored door to provide an extra layer of defense against the elements.

– Periodic Inspection: Periodically inspect your door for any signs of wear or damage, and address any issues promptly to prevent further deterioration.
